>百科大全> 列表
win11堆栈的缓冲区溢出怎么解决
时间:2025-05-12 23:18:27
答案

解决办法如下:输入验证:在接收用户输入之前,对输入进行验证,确保其长度不会超过预留内存空间的大小。可以使用内置函数或自定义函数来控制输入的大小,并处理异常情况

栈溢出检测:可以使用一些工具或技术来检测程序中的堆栈溢出漏洞,例如使用堆栈保护工具,这些工具会在堆栈上放置一个特殊的值,当溢出发生时,这个特殊值会被覆盖,从而触发异常或警报。

win11堆栈的缓冲区溢出怎么解决
答案

要解决win11堆栈的缓冲区溢出问题,可以使用以下方法。

首先,编写安全的代码并确保输入不会超出缓冲区的大小。

其次,使用编译器提供的特性,如堆栈保护和地址随机化,来防止缓冲区溢出攻击。

最后,定期更新操作系统应用程序,以修复可能存在的漏洞和弱点。这些措施可以显著减少堆栈的缓冲区溢出风险,提高系统的安全性和稳定性

win11夏普7040怎么安装扫描
答案

若要将夏普7040扫描仪连接到电脑进行扫描操作,请遵循以下步骤

1. 首先,确保您的电脑和夏普7040扫描仪都处于开启状态并连接到同一局域网。

2. 在您的电脑上打开Web浏览器,输入夏普7040扫描仪的IP地址。您可以在扫描仪的控制面板上或说明书中找到该信息

3. 在浏览器中,登录扫描仪的管理界面。输入正确的用户名和密码。如果您没有进行过更改,可以尝试使用默认的用户名和密码进行登录。

4. 在管理界面中,找到扫描设置或网络设置菜单,查看网络连接选项。

5. 确保夏普7040扫描仪已与您的电脑连接。您可以通过有线连接(如USB)或通过无线网络连接。

6. 根据您的连接方式选择相应的设置选项。如果是有线连接,可能需要选择USB扫描模式或类似选项。如果是无线连接,则需要选择正确的Wi-Fi网络并输入相应的密码。

7. 保存设置后,关闭浏览器。

8. 打开您电脑上的扫描软件(例如Adobe Acrobat、Windows Fax和扫描或其他第三方软件),选择扫描选项,然后选择夏普7040扫描仪作为默认扫描设备。

9. 在扫描软件中选择所需的扫描设置(如文件格式、解析度、目标文件夹等)。

10. 点击“扫描”按钮开始扫描。

请注意,这只是一般的步骤指引,具体操作可能因扫描仪型号和软件配置而有所不同。强烈建议参考夏普7040扫描仪的用户手册或联系夏普客户支持获取准确的连接和扫描操作指南。

推荐
© 2025 阿布百科网